Pedro’s transfer misery

Pedro Caixinha is likely to have NO new faces to work with when Sevco report for pre-season training on Monday.

Despite the carefully planned transfer frenzy to give the impression of a spending spree it’ll be a case of deja-vu when last season’s flops report back to Murray Park.

After doing the bouncy with fans and posing for selfies following the May 21 win over St Johnstone Caixinha said: “We are going to start the [pre] season on 5 June and we intend to have as many [new] players as we can in that period of time. It will be something very different next season, definitely.”

As the cones and bibs come out to prepare for the Europa League qualifier on June 29 Bruno Alves will be on international duty with Portugal while Ryan Jack prepares for his wedding on Friday.

A week of negotiating with Norwich who are desperate to bin Graham Dorrans has resulted in a headline grabbing bid of close to £1m being made.

The grapevine suggests a down payment of £250,000 with similar payments to be made in the summer of 2018 and 2019. Given their toxic credit rating Norwich have treated that bid with the contempt that it deserves.

Yesterday Carlos Pena made a brief but highly publicised trip to Glasgow before jetting back to Mexico without signing a contract.

A work permit is required where Sevco will state the case for signing the chunky midfielder- this season he has played two full games for Leon while on loan from Guadalajara.

Other Mexican’s are apparently ready to jet in but as soon as a transfer fee is mentioned interest is likely to be dropped as quickly as Motherwell priced Louis Moult out of his dream move.
